The US Coast Guard makes sure that all boats have B-1 marine fire extinguishers. Depending on how big your boat is, you may need more than one of these. Any ship less than 26 feet long must have a B-1 fire extinguisher. Any boat between 26 and 40 feet long must have at least two B-1 fire extinguishers on board.

What kinds of things make up a VDS pyrotechnic?
The US Coast Guard has approved the following pyrotechnic visual distress signals and devices to go with them: Red pyrotechnic flares that can be held in your hand or launched from the air. Orange smoke can be controlled in your hand or float in the air. These are launchers for red meteors or parachute flares.
ACCORDING TO THE UNITED STATES COAST GUARD, Class A vessels are Personal Watercraft (PWCs). Because of this, the federal government has the same rules for PWCs as it does for boats that are less than 16 feet long. But driving a PWC is very different from driving a boat regarding how you steer and how well it works.
